Abstract: | We theoretically demonstrate the feasibility of using a grating-waveguide structure (GWS) as a loss-tolerant, narrow-band
reflector in the UV. We simulate device operation using a Green-function technique. Our numerical simulations indicate that
a GWS with a 25-nm grating can be used as a 95% reflector for 157-nm light, even in the presence of intensity absorptions
of 50 cm-1.
